1. ホーム
  2. .net

[解決済み] VS2017/2015 で .xproj ファイルを開く方法

2022-02-11 05:51:44

質問

.NET core プロジェクトで、拡張子が .xproj . VS 2017 でプロジェクトを開くと、プロジェクトファイル .xproj migrated to .csproj .

.xproj ファイル Visual studio 2017 / 2015 を開くには?

何かツールのインストールは必要ですか?

VS2015 で xproj を開こうとしたところ。インポートしたプロジェクトは、次のようなエラーが表示されます。 "C:\Program Files (x86)\MSBuild\Microsoft\VisualStudio\v14.0\DotNet\Microsoft.‌​DotNet.Props" was not found. Confirm that the path in the <Import> declaration is correct, and that the file exists on disk.

何かツールのインストールは必要ですか?

解決方法は?

  1. すでに説明したように、project.json と .xproj は非推奨であり、Microsoft ではもうサポートされていません。VS 2017では、VS 2017で作成されたソリューションを移行することができ、実行することができます。 dotnet migrate をコマンドラインから実行します。

  2. VS 2015(2015のみ)でproject.json/xprojの作業を継続する方法があり、その方法は global.json ファイルを作成し、sdk->version の値をインストールした preview2 cli のバージョンに設定します(バージョンに正確に一致するフォルダが、このディレクトリに存在する必要があります)。 C:\Program Files\dotnet\sdk というエラーメッセージが表示されます。 Microsoft.‌​DotNet.Props was not found ). 参照 https://github.com/dotnet/cli/blob/rel/1.0.1/Documentation/ProjectJsonToCSProj.md#how-do-i-work-with-projectjson-and-csproj-on-the-same-machine をご覧ください。